On May 5, 2024, we changed our company name from Space Entertainment Laboratory Inc. to HAMA Inc. This new name reflects our deep connection to the Hama-dori region of Fukushima Prefecture, where our headquarters is located. Hama-dori was one of the areas most severely affected by the Great East Japan Earthquake and the subsequent nuclear disaster on March 11, 2011. Under the national Fukushima Innovation Coast Framework, extensive efforts have been made to rebuild and establish a new industrial foundation in the region. HAMA Inc. is committed to continuing its work as a technology-driven company rooted in this recovering area. Our goal is to support the revitalization of Hama-dori as a hub of advanced innovation and to contribute to its growth—now and in the future. Just as the region has shown remarkable resilience in the face of adversity, we aim to embody that same spirit as an organization that never gives up, regardless of the challenges it faces. Our name, “HAMA,” is a tribute to this region’s strength and to our unwavering dedication to it. The name HAMA also carries another symbolic meaning. In Japanese tradition, a hamaya (破魔矢) is a ceremonial arrow given as a good-luck charm during the New Year to ward off misfortune. Japan faces a range of national challenges—from natural disasters and climate change to issues of security. The advanced technologies we develop are designed to counter these very threats, much like the hamaya itself. Through our work, we aspire to serve as a force of protection—defending the future of Japan and the world, and contributing to the realization of a safe and prosperous society.

Company History

2014Established Space Entertainment Laboratory Inc. in Ota Ward, Tokyo
2018Launched R&D of the HAMADORI series of seaplane-type UAV
2022Relocated headquarters to Minamisoma City, Fukushima Prefecture(Minamisoma Incubation Center)
2023Opened R&D Center in Yokohama, Kanagawa Prefecture(Yokohama Hardtech Hub)
2024Commenced full-scale UAV design and development services
2025Renamed the company to HAMA Inc. and restructured operations in line with business expansion
